コード例 #1
0
        // View individual developer by ID
        private void DisplayIndividualDeveloperByID()
        {
            Developer newDeveloper = new Developer();

            Console.Clear();
            // Prompt the user to give me a DeveloperID
            Console.WriteLine("Enter the DeveloperID of the developer you'd like to see:");

            // Get the user's input
            string newDevIDNumber = Console.ReadLine();

            newDeveloper.IDNumber = int.Parse(newDevIDNumber);

            // Find the developer by that DeveloperID
            Developer programmer = _programmerRepo.GetDeveloperByIDNumber(newDeveloper.IDNumber);

            // Display said DeveloperID if it isn't null
            if (programmer != null)
            {
                Console.WriteLine($"Developer ID: {programmer.IDNumber}\n" +
                                  $"First Name: {programmer.DeveloperFirstName}\n" +
                                  $"Last Name: {programmer.DeveloperLastName}\n" +
                                  $"PluralSight: {programmer.PluralSight}");
            }
            else
            {
                Console.WriteLine("no developer by that id.");
            }
        }